Engineered Wood Installation in Arvada, CO

Engineered wood installation involves the precise placement of manufactured wood products designed for durability, stability, and aesthetic appeal. This service covers a variety of projects, including flooring, wall paneling, and custom cabinetry, providing a versatile option for upgrading residential interiors. Homeowners typically want to understand the different types of engineered wood available, such as laminate, veneer, or composite options, as well as the preparation required for a successful installation. Clarifying the scope of work, including surface preparation, subfloor conditions, and finishing options, helps ensure the project meets expectations.

Before requesting engineered wood installation, property owners should consider the specific requirements of their space, such as moisture levels, traffic exposure, and the desired look. It’s important to inquire about the installation process, including whether existing flooring needs removal or if additional surface repairs are necessary. Understanding the maintenance needs and lifespan of different engineered wood products can also aid in making an informed decision. Proper planning and communication help ensure the finished project enhances the property's functionality and aesthetic appeal.

Common Engineered Wood Installation Jobs

Engineered Wood Flooring - provides a durable and stable surface for living areas and kitchens.

Subfloor Preparation - ensures a smooth, level base for proper installation of engineered wood.

Room Transitions - creates seamless connections between different flooring types and areas.

Underlayment Installation - adds cushioning and soundproofing for enhanced comfort underfoot.

Moisture Barrier Setup - protects engineered wood from moisture damage in basements and bathrooms.

Floor Repair and Replacement - restores damaged or worn engineered wood to improve appearance and function.

Engineered Wood Installation Questions

What types of projects are suitable for engineered wood installation? Engineered wood is ideal for flooring, wall panels, and custom furniture in residential and commercial spaces.

How does engineered wood differ from solid wood? Engineered wood is made with layered construction, providing greater stability and resistance to moisture compared to solid wood.

What should homeowners consider before installing engineered wood? It's important to evaluate the subfloor condition, room humidity levels, and the desired finish to ensure proper installation.

Is engineered wood su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, engineered wood is durable and often designed to withstand frequent use, making it suitable for hallways and busy rooms.
